The only home in England designed by the architect has new galleries added to an adjoining building.
An extension on a house that was the architect Charles Rennie Mackintosh's final commission has been completed.
Designed and remodelled by the Glasgow architect in 1916, 78 Derngate is the only place where his style can be seen in its original setting. Local people united with members of the Charles Rennie Mackintosh Society to campaign for its preservation and it opened to the public in 2004.The house in Northampton is the only one in England designed by Charles Rennie Mackintosh
The £950,000 two-storey glass extension means there is now twice as much gallery space as before and a new shop and education centre.Image source,Ms Jansson said the space was "fantastic" and worked "seamlessly" with the original buildings. "It is like it has always been here," she said.
